Germany’s SMS Mevac to supply RH plant for Tubos Reunidos

Wednesday, 29 August 2012 16:40:50 (GMT+3)   |  
German plantmaker SMS Siemag has announced that its subsidiary SMS Mevac has received an order from Spain-based pipe producer Tubos Reunidos for the supply of an RH plant.
 
The plant will be designed to produce 400,000 mt per year of steel of high cleanness in terms of inclusions and with ultra-low gas contents for the manufacture of seamless steel pipes.  With this plant scheduled to be commissioned in the third quarter of 2013, Tubos Reunidos will fulfill the demanded requirements on steel cleanness.
